Sweet, Salty, and Fermented

Southern cane yielded rare sugars; soybeans became sauces, pastes, and tofu that traveled well. Salted fish and pickles provisioned armies and canal crews. Preserving food was strategy — stretching harvests to power caravans and cities.

In a world defined by shifting landscapes and burgeoning civilizations, the Tang Dynasty, flourishing from 618 to 907 CE, emerges as a pivotal chapter in Chinese history. This period marked not only the zenith of artistic and cultural expression but also an intriguing evolution in agricultural practices, particularly regarding staple crops. As the dawn of the 6th century arose, the region known today as North China began to witness a remarkable transformation. Wheat, once a minor crop, began its rise to prominence, gradually overshadowing millet as the cornerstone of the Chinese diet. This change was driven by ratcheting demands for flour-based foods and improvements in agricultural techniques, which would lay the groundwork for a thriving society harnessed by its own agricultural innovations.

Picture the vibrant fields of the Guanzhong Basin in Shaanxi, where the sun spills its golden rays on diverse crops. By the late 7th century, multi-cropping systems came into play here, weaving a tapestry of foxtail millet and wheat, supplemented by an assortment of crops such as broomcorn millet, soybeans, adzuki beans, and barley. Yet, rice remained on the fringes, its utility limited in comparison. This agricultural complexity not only reflects a deepening connection to the land, but also conveys the resilience of communities as they adapted their diets to the changing demands of a growing population.

Understanding the depth of this transformation requires looking back at archaeological evidence from sites like Matengkong, stretching back to the late Warring States and Qin Dynasty periods. These findings reveal that the cultivation of wheat was already taking root, yielding results that echoed those of foxtail millet — an indication that dietary staples were shifting, acquiring new dimensions of richness and variety. During this period, the establishment of the Bao Gu system within the Tang Code was revolutionary. This system mandated advance medical payments that were bound to the recovery of injured agricultural laborers. A legal framework protecting the agricultural workforce allowed communities to flourish more securely. By ensuring that a laborer could recuperate without the fear of financial ruin, it wove a safety net for a society dependent on its working hands. This discreet layer of legal protection operated behind the scenes, directly linking the health of individuals to the overall productivity of agriculture.

Highlights

  • In the 6th to 9th centuries, the Tang Dynasty saw the establishment of wheat as a staple crop in North China, gradually overtaking millet in importance due to improved agricultural practices and increased demand for flour-based foods. - By the late 7th century, the Guanzhong Basin (Shaanxi) featured a multi-cropping system, with foxtail millet (Setaria italica) and wheat (Triticum aestivum) as dominant crops, supplemented by broomcorn millet, soybean, adzuki bean, barley, cannabis, and rice, the latter being of lowest utilization. - Archaeobotanical evidence from the Matengkong site (late Warring States to Qin Dynasty, overlapping with early centuries CE) shows that wheat planting played a consistent and important role in agricultural production, with yields comparable to foxtail millet, indicating a shift in dietary staples. -
